Understanding Audi A4 Key Technology
Audi's security systems have progressed considerably over the years. To comprehend the replacement procedure, one need to initially identify which generation of key technology the specific Audi A4 makes use of.
1. Traditional Flip Keys (B5 and B6 Platforms)
Found mainly in designs from the late 1990s to the mid-2000s, these keys include a physical metal blade that flips out of a plastic fob. While they look easier, they still contain a transponder chip that must be synced to the car's Engine Control Unit (ECU).
2. Integrated Fob Keys (B7 and B8 Platforms)
Starting around 2005, the Audi A4 moved toward a more integrated design. These keys typically involve a "dash-insertion" technique where the entire fob is pushed into a slot to begin the engine. These utilize more intricate rolling code encryption.
3. Audi Advanced Key (Smart Keys)
Most modern-day Audi A4 designs (B9 platform and late B8) make use of the "Advanced Key" system. This permits keyless entry and push-button start. The car spots the presence of the key via proximity sensing units. These secrets are the most highly dense and, subsequently, the most pricey to replace.
Typical Features of Audi A4 Keys:
Transponder Chips: Small electronic chips that interact with the ignition to disable the immobilizer.Rolling Codes: A security feature where the code transmitted by the key modifications after every use to prevent "code grabbing" by thieves.Remote Keyless Entry (RKE): Buttons for locking/unlocking doors and opening the trunk.Emergency Blade: A concealed physical key inside the fob used to by hand unlock the door if the fob battery dies.When is a Replacement Necessary?

No matter the selected service provider, the procedure for replacing an Audi A4 key follows a standard set of steps to ensure security and performance.
1. Verification of Ownership
Audi maintains strict security procedures. To acquire a new key, the owner needs to normally provide:
The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N).Proof of automobile ownership (Title or Registration).A legitimate government-issued picture ID.2. Cutting the Blade
Even for keyless start models, a physical "emergency blade" must be cut. This is done utilizing a high-precision laser cutter. For Audi, this is frequently a "sidewinder" or "laser-cut" key, which features a serpentine groove cut into the center of the blade instead of notches on the edges.
3. Setting the Transponder
This is the most technical phase. A diagnostic tool is linked to the car's OBD-II port. For more recent Audi A4s, the locksmith or dealer must connect to Audi's "FAZIT" database in Germany to license the new key and "present" it to the car's immobilizer system.
4. Establishing Remote Functions
Once the engine is effectively starting with the new key, the specialist will configure the remote buttons for the locks, alarm, and trunk.
Approximated Costs by Model Year
The cost of a replacement depends heavily on the year of the Audi A4. More recent designs need more sophisticated software and more pricey hardware.
Table 2: Estimated Replacement Costs (Parts & & Labor)Audi A4 GenerationProduction YearsApproximated Total CostB5/ B61994-- 2005₤ 150-- ₤ 250B72005-- 2008₤ 250-- ₤ 400B82009-- 2016₤ 350-- ₤ 550B9/ Current2017-- Present₤ 500-- ₤ 800
Note: Prices are estimates and can vary based upon geographical area and whether the owner has actually lost all keys (which adds a "discovery" cost).

Can I configure a brand-new Audi A4 key myself?For the majority of designs built after 2000, the answer is no. Audi keys require specific diagnostic software application (such as ODIS or high-end locksmith tools) and a safe connection to the producer's database to set the immobilizer chip.
What should I do if my key is taken?If a key is taken, it is vital to have the car "re-keyed" digitally. A locksmith professional or dealer can access the car's computer system and erase the lost key from the system's memory, ensuring that even if the burglar has the physical key, it will no longer begin the engine.
Does a locksmith's key look various from the dealership's key?If the locksmith uses an O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) key, it will be similar. If they use a "universal" or aftermarket key, the internal electronic devices are typically the very same, however the plastic housing may do not have the Audi four-rings logo.
My Audi A4 key won't kip down the ignition-- is the key broken?This is typical in older B5 and B6 models. It might be a damaged key blade or a stopping working ignition lock cylinder. Before ordering a new key, a locksmith must inspect the cylinder to see if it needs repair.
Can I purchase a used audi a4 replacement key key from eBay and utilize it?This is usually dissuaded. Many Audi secrets are "locked" to the VIN of the very first car they were configured to. When a key is set, it frequently can not be overwritten or "re-flashed" for a various automobile without specialized, costly devices that many DIYers do not have.
